300 FNUS56 KLOX 182313 FWFLOX Fire Weather Planning Forecast For Southwestern California National Weather Service Los Angeles/Oxnard CA 413 PM PDT Wed Sep 18 2024 ...MODERATE RISK OF FLASH FLOODING AND DEBRIS FLOWS OVER SOME INTERIOR MOUNTAINS AND VALLEYS THURSDAY, FLASH FLOOD WATCH ISSUED... ...CHANCE OF SHOWERS AND THUNDERSTORMS THURSDAY THROUGH FRIDAY... .DISCUSSION... An unseasonable low pressure system, currently 100 miles west of Monterey, will swing through southwest California Thursday into Friday. This will result in continued cool and moist conditions through Friday. This system is unstable, and the chance for thunderstorms and locally heavy rain is growing. The greatest risk is over interior San Luis Obispo, Santa Barbara, and Ventura Counties where several projections are showing rain rates exceeding 1 inch per hour. This includes the Hurricane and Apache burn scars where there is a moderate risk for significant debris flows. The Lake Fire is also of concern, but the risk is lower. While most of the projections push the system off to the east by Friday, some are much slower and shift the risks into Los Angeles County on Friday. While the risk is low for debris flows over the Post and Bridge burn scars, it is not zero and will continue to be assessed. Coastal and valley areas also have a chance for rain, but the risk for heavy rain is very low. Winds will be light tonight, then increase on Thursday and Friday with a significant wind shift from southeast to northwest as the low moves through. High pressure will quickly build aloft over the weekend, with steady and significant warming and drying into early next week.
